How hashmap are implemented

Web26 jun. 2024 · Working of get () method : 1. The key is used to calculate the hash value by calling private hash (key) method, internally hash (key) method call hashCode () method … Web13 sep. 2024 · How HashMap is implemented c++? i.e. if the range of key values is very small, then most of the hash table is not used and chains get longer. Below is the Hash …

Hash Tables and Hashmaps in Python Besant Technologies

WebAnswer (1 of 2): Before diving into the details of how Java's HashMap functions internally, there are four things we should be aware of: Based on the hashing principle, HashMap … WebHash table based implementation of the Map interface. This implementation provides all of the optional map operations, and permits null values and the null key. (The HashMap … ion titisor https://visualseffect.com

Internal Working of LinkedHashMap in Java - Dinesh on Java

Web18 aug. 2024 · HashMap is a dictionary data structure provided by java. It’s a Map-based collection class that is used to store data in Key & Value pairs. In this article, we’ll be … Web6 nov. 2024 · Let’s note down the internal working of put method in hashmap. First of all, the key object is checked for null. If the key is null, the value is stored in table [0] … WebAs we have discussed the Hashing implementation of the LinkedHashMap same as the HashMap hashing implementation, we have already discussed in this article. Let’s see … ion-title center

Hash Tables and Hashmaps in Python Besant Technologies

Category:How the Go runtime implements maps efficiently (without …

Tags:How hashmap are implemented

How hashmap are implemented

How HashMap Works in Java Internal Implementation of HashMap

WebGitHub - ZenMan123/HashMap: Implemented HashMap with Robin Hood optimization ZenMan123 / HashMap Public Notifications Fork 0 Star 1 Code Issues Pull requests … Web18 feb. 2024 · The reason for using LinkedList in the HashMap implementation is because it has an \mathcal O (1) O(1) insertion and \mathcal O (1) O(1) deletion. I will explain …

How hashmap are implemented

Did you know?

WebHashMap has an array of nodes, and each node is represented by a class. Internally, it stores Key and Value in an array and LinkedList data structure. How HashMap are … Web3 sep. 2024 · A quick and practical guide to Hashmap's internals. In this article, we are going to explore the most popular implementation of Map interface from the Java …

WebHashmaps or Hash Tables in Python are implemented via the built-in data type. The keys of the built-in data type are generated with the help of a hashing function. The dictionary elements are not designed to be ordered and therefore they can be easily changed. Web版权声明:本文为小斑马学习总结文章,技术来源于韦东山著作,转载请注明出处! 最近无意中发现有很多对Map尤其是HashMap的线程安全性的话题讨论,在我的理解中,对HashMap的理解中也就知道它是线程不安全的,以及HashMap的底层算法采用了链地址法来解决哈希冲突的知识,但是对其线程安全性的 ...

Web15 mei 2024 · Hashmap ( unsigned int blockSize): m_blockSize (blockSize) { if (m_blockSize > MAX_BLOCK_SIZE) { m_blockSize = MAX_BLOCK_SIZE; } else if (m_blockSize > objBlock = std::make_shared> (); m_blocks.push_back (objBlock); } } catch (const std::exception& e) { std::cerr << e.what () << '\n'; throw e; } } … Web8 okt. 2024 · This post illustrated how HashMap (or HashTable) can be implemented with an array-based linked list. You can take a look more examples on Cracking the Coding Interview by Gayle Laakmann McDowell. HashMap Vs. TreeMap Vs. HashTable Vs. LinkedHashMap by Ryan Wang — We … Yogen Rai - Java HashMap Implementation in a Nutshell - DZone

Web17 jun. 2024 · HashMap Class The most common class that implements the Java Map interface is the HashMap. It is a hash table based implementation of the Map interface. It implements all of the Map operations and allows null values and one null key. Also, this class does not maintain any order among its elements.

WebIn this list, I have shared almost 40 popular Java Interview questions, which are based upon how HashMap are implemented, how you use them, difference between HashMap and … on the holdWeb27 sep. 2024 · In our previous article, we have seen internal implementation of SynchronizedMap and the difference between HashMap, Hashtable, SynchronizedMap … iontm#3702Web2 jul. 2024 · HashSet internally uses HashMap. Now coming back to internal implementation of HashSet in Java the most important point is HashSet class … on the holidays 2023Web24 mrt. 2024 · A HashMap provides a way to store and retrieve key-value pairs in a way that is efficient and fast. An internal HashMap is also known as an open addressing or closed … on the holidays worksheetWeb3 aug. 2024 · How HashMap works in java? HashMap in java use it’s inner class Node for storing mappings. HashMap works on hashing algorithm and uses … on the holistic nature of formulaic languageWeb11 apr. 2024 · HashSet is a collection that stores unique elements, meaning it does not allow duplicate values. It is implemented using a hash table, which means the elements are stored in a hash table using... on the holidayWeb22 dec. 2024 · Basically, HashMap is one of the most popular Collection classes in java.HashMap internally uses HashTable implementation.This HashMap class extends … on the holidays recount